In the interest of grabbing data points to plan for some tools for you all, I'm curious what the ratio of users are around here.

How many of y'all are strictly Game mode users, and how many of y'all use it like a laptop?

A lot of what I do on the Deck requires Desktop mode, mainly to get at a terminal and to configure Steam for pirated games. However, that doesn't mean I couldn't devise a tool that launches from Game mode to do the same things.

I suspect the latter is going to end up being something that I need to build to be the most useful to a wider audience, but for being pirates I'm sure most of you have entered Desktop mode numerous times for one reason or another.

How do you use it for video? Plex?

[–] [email protected] 2 points 2 days ago

Nope. Just installed vlc and either stream from my nas or USB drive. I'm a fan of simple

[–] [email protected] 1 points 2 days ago

Besides VLC, another option is to use Kodi. Install via Discover Store and add to your Steam library. It's slightly easier to use in Game mode with a controller.
